In Exercise 16, the regression model Combined MPG = 33.46 - 3.23 Displacement relates cars’ engine size to their fuel economy (Combined mpg). Explain what the slope means.


Data From Exercise 16

In Chapter 6, Exercise 41 we examined the relationship between the fuel economy (CombinedMPG) and Displacement (in liters) for 1211 models of cars. (Data in Fuel Economy 2016) Further analysis produces the regression model CombinedMPG 33.46 3.23.Displacement. If the car you are thinking of buying has a 4 liter engine, what does this model suggest your gas mileage would be?
